High Power PIN Diode Microwave Switch
Signal Technology Olektron Operation has entered the
High Power PIN Diode Microwave Switch
market segment. Switches operating within
the range of 100 MHz to 18 GHz, operating at power levels of up to 400W CW or
4KW peak, represent new capability for the Olektron Operation. Standard
offerings will begin with a 100 Watt SPDT design. Custom devices are also being
offered.
Digital
To address the
current and emerging needs of digitally encoded systems designers, we have
developed a family of high performance digital switching matrices. The devices
are designed for use in communication, control and remote management, and
telemetry. Our broad hardware experience enables us to offer solutions in many
physical layer protocols and mixed environments to suit varied applications such
as:
-
Bipolar - Telephony (E1/T1 through E3/T3), Data (RS-232)
-
Unipolar - TTL, ECL
-
Differential - Data (RS-422, RS-485), ECL
-
Optical - 820nm, 1310nm
-
Hardware Transparent
Most Digital Switch Matrix
Products feature signal paths that are not sensitive to modulation format and
rate. This allows the user to switch different format signals within the same
matrix.

Radio Frequency (RF)
Signal Technology's Radio Frequency
Switch Matrix Products are the pinnacles of performance for receiver front-end
radio frequency switching. Many different frequency bands and ranges are
available. These devices feature broadband frequency coverage and ultra wide
dynamic (amplitude) range. Each unit's low noise floor and high intercept points
allow operators to hear weak signals without being desensitized by the strong
signals.
Most Popular Bands:
-
Very Low Frequency (VLF), 10 KHz 2 MHz
-
High Frequency (HF), 2 30 MHz
-
Very High Frequency (VHF), 30 300 MHz
-
Ultra High Frequency (UHF), 300 MHz 3 GHz
-
Intermediate Frequencies (IF), 455 KHz 160 MHz
